About F. K. Orcutt

F. K. Orcutt is a scholar working on Mechanical Engineering, General Materials Science and Mechanics of Materials, having authored 19 papers that have together received 351 indexed citations. Recurring topics across this work include Tribology and Lubrication Engineering (16 papers), Gear and Bearing Dynamics Analysis (10 papers) and Lubricants and Their Additives (5 papers). The work is most often cited by research in Mechanical Engineering (329 citations), Mechanics of Materials (119 citations) and Control and Systems Engineering (106 citations). F. K. Orcutt has collaborated with scholars based in United Kingdom, United States and Russia. Frequent co-authors include J. W. Lund, L. B. Sibley, C.W.W. Ng, H. S. Cheng, Charles M. Allen, H. H. Krause, C. H. T. Pan and Jens Lund. Their work appears in journals such as Wear, Journal of Lubrication Technology and A S L E Transactions.
